From 15d8cadbda540af56f906b001ba8d425a06c35a9 Mon Sep 17 00:00:00 2001 From: Oliver Davies Date: Wed, 19 Dec 2018 20:30:35 +0000 Subject: [PATCH] Fix spacing, add isActive method --- assets/js/components/Navbar.vue | 68 ++++++++++++++++++--------------- 1 file changed, 37 insertions(+), 31 deletions(-) diff --git a/assets/js/components/Navbar.vue b/assets/js/components/Navbar.vue index b9b063ae..60b80515 100644 --- a/assets/js/components/Navbar.vue +++ b/assets/js/components/Navbar.vue @@ -22,7 +22,7 @@ :href="item.href" class="block text-black focus:text-white focus:no-underline focus-within:bg-blue p-4 border-l-3 sm:border-l-0 sm:border-b-3 border-transparent hover:border-grey-light sm:ml-4 sm:mr-0 sm:p-0 hover:no-underline" :class="{ - 'border-blue hover:border-blue': pageUrl.match(new RegExp(item.pattern)), + 'border-blue hover:border-blue': isActive(item), }" > @@ -35,41 +35,47 @@